What is Cryptocurrency Trading?

Cryptocurrency trading involves speculating on price movements of digital assets like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and altcoins through exchanges. Traders aim to buy low and sell high, leveraging market volatility. Unlike long-term “HODLing,” trading focuses on short-to-medium-term opportunities using technical analysis, market sentiment, and economic indicators to time entries and exits.

How Cryptocurrency Trading Works

Trading occurs on centralized (CEX) and decentralized exchanges (DEX). Basic steps include:

  1. Selecting a reputable exchange and completing KYC verification
  2. Funding your account with fiat currency or crypto
  3. Analyzing charts using indicators like RSI and MACD
  4. Placing buy/sell orders (market, limit, or stop orders)
  5. Monitoring positions and executing exit strategies

Most traders use candlestick charts to identify patterns signaling potential price movements.

Top 4 Cryptocurrency Trading Strategies

Day Trading

Opening and closing positions within 24 hours to capitalize on intraday volatility. Requires constant market monitoring.

Swing Trading

Holding assets for days/weeks to capture larger price swings. Uses technical analysis to identify trend reversals.

Scalping

Making dozens of micro-trades daily to profit from tiny price fluctuations. Demands lightning-fast execution.

Arbitrage

Exploiting price differences across exchanges. Requires sophisticated tools to detect momentary imbalances.

Risk Management Techniques

Surviving crypto volatility requires disciplined risk control:

  1. Never invest more than 5% of capital in a single trade
  2. Always use stop-loss orders to limit downside
  3. Diversify across different crypto sectors (DeFi, NFTs, Layer 1s)
  4. Keep 50%+ of assets in cold storage wallets
  5. Regularly take profits during bull runs

Tax Implications of Crypto Trading

Most countries treat crypto as property, meaning trades trigger taxable events. Key considerations:

  • Short-term gains often taxed as ordinary income
  • Long-term holdings may qualify for lower capital gains rates
  • Losses can offset capital gains taxes
  • Record-keeping tools like Koinly simplify tax reporting

FAQ: Cryptocurrency Trading Explained

How much money do I need to start crypto trading?

You can start with as little as $50 on most exchanges, but $500-$1,000 provides better flexibility for risk management.

What’s the best cryptocurrency for beginners?

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H) offer the highest liquidity and stability. Avoid low-cap altcoins until you gain experience.

Can I trade crypto without KYC verification?

Some DEXs like Uniswap allow trading without ID, but most major exchanges require KYC for fiat deposits and withdrawals.

How do I avoid cryptocurrency scams?

Never share private keys, avoid “guaranteed returns” schemes, double-check wallet addresses, and use hardware wallets for large holdings.
